Henry Edward Horan, D.S.C., ( – ) was an officer in the Royal Navy.

Life & Career

Horan was appointed Lieutenant in Command of the first-class torpedo boat T.B. 29 on 14 December, 1914.[1]

Horan was appointed in command of the destroyer Wessex on 31 August, 1918.[2]

In July, 1937, Horan was appointed in command of the battleship Barham.[3]
